What is a multiplier and its role in the game

Multiplier is the multiplier by which the payout is multiplied for a combination of symbols or for the entire round. His task is to increase the player's final result without changing the original rules for dropping combinations. Multipliers do not affect RTP or the probability of winning, but they significantly increase the payout, which makes the game more exciting.

Basic principle of operation

1. Winning formation
The player collects the winning combination according to the paytable. For example, a combination of characters brings 20 AUD.

2. Applying a multiplier
If this win is multiplied by × 3, the amount is automatically increased to 60 AUD.

3. Activation methods

through special characters (for example, Wild with a factor of × 2 or × 5),
in bonus rounds (multiplier applied to all winnings during freespins),
during cascade rotations (each new cascade increases the multiplier),
randomly (random events embedded in slot mechanics).

Thus, a multiplier is a tool that is added on top of the standard slot math, reinforcing the final payout.

Multiplier Types and How They Work

1. Fixed factors

Always have the same value (for example, × 2, × 3, × 5).
Applied when the corresponding character appears.

2. Cumulative multipliers

Their value increases during the game, for example, with each cascading win or spin series.
In slots like * Gonzo's Questoni can reach × 15 or higher.

3. Random factors

Activated without a predictable algorithm.
Used to add the element of surprise and a sharp increase in payments.

4. Global Bonus Round Multipliers

They act not on one combination, but on all winnings within the bonus (freespins or special games).
Allow you to get big wins even with small bets.

Application examples

Sweet Bonanza (Pragmatic Play): During freespins, multiplier bombs up to × 100 can drop out, multiplying the winning amount by the entire spin.
Dead or Alive II (NetEnt): Sticky Wild with multipliers that add up in the bonus.
Money Train 2/3 (Relax Gaming): Special characters in the bonus add and accumulate multipliers that yield huge odds at the end of the round.
